
Troop 240 was founded in 1954 with the purpose of teaching youth leadership, life skills, and citizenship values . We achieve this through outdoor activities, community service, and encouraging responsibility. We have a year-round energetic program to engage our scouts.
Our Troop puts the “outing” in “Scouting”! We are an active Troop with a long history of hiking, biking, backpacking, and paddle craft. Our paddle craft program consists of both canoes and sea kayaks that allow us to do day or weekend excursions all over Oregon and Washington. Our camping outings are goal oriented to help the scouts develop skills and build life experiences.
We are chartered through American Legion Post 6 in Hillsboro and are proud to support our local veterans.
Our Troop is truly a scout-led organization. They are the decision makers in the activities and achievements that are done within the Troop, We pride ourselves on how we promote the majority of our scouts to Eagle Rank—the highest honor in scouting.
